Choosing Poverty

Born to German nobility, Norbert (c. 1080-1134) was raised amid the splendor of the royal court and -- in his youth -- was always ready for a good time. As many sons of nobility did, he took minor orders (up to subdeacon) out of worldly motives: social prominence and financial rewards. A near fatal accident worked a miraculuous change in Norbert, who responded to the voice of the Lord speaking to his heart, ''Turn from evil and do good. Seek peace and pursue it.''

He embraced prayer and penance, gave his wealth to the poor, and was ordained a priest. Even when he was ordained a bishop, he continued to embrace poverty. Legend has it the porter refused to let Norbert into the bishop's residence, assuming he was a beggar.
